Perimeter Heating

HCP's Perimeter Heating range offers a choice of either Low Pressure Hot Water (LPHW) or electric heating elements. As the name implies, Perimeter Heating is usually located around the perimeter of a building and on the external walls, where the heat loss is greatest.

Perimeter Heating casings can be independently supported at low, medium or high levels to give continuous heating along walls or walkways and is ideally suited for combating cold down draughts and condensation, characteristics often associated with full and half height glazing.

Drawings

Detailed below is a traditional wall-mounted heating system, but HCP can design and manufacture systems to match space restrictions or output requirements.

  1. Heating Elements are made from copper tube with aluminium fins. They take standard capilliary fittings
  2. Wall Mounting Brackets
  3. Heating Element Hangers
  4. Front Panel
  5. Centre Mullion is shown, left-hand, right hand and closed end options available
  6. External Corner Cover Panel (internal also available)
  7. Outlet Grilles are continuous aluminium extrusions. Standard finish of silver anodised AA5 (Punched slotted outlet also available).

Specifications

HCP’s elements are manufactured from copper tubing, which are available in diameters of 15, 22 or 28mm; enhancing the heating output is a profiled grille of extruded aluminium.

Our standard systems are available in five sizes, but by increasing or decreasing the diameter of the copper tubing and aluminium grille, the length of the element and/or the number of elements a wide range of heating outputs can be achieved.

Performance

The performance data below can be applied to the TG (Top Grille outlet), STG (Sloping Top Grille outlet) and FG (Front Grill outlet) units.

HCP offer four widths of casing: A, F, N and W; 40, 60, 90 and 120mm in width respectively. Performance based on the unit height and number of elements (SR & DR) is detailed below.

HEAT OUTPUTS - WATTS/FINNED METRE
    Element Type
Unit Height (mm) Element A*
(40mm wide)
F & J
(60mm wide)
N
(90mm wide)
W
(120mm wide)
150 SR 280 482 684 -
200 SR 300 523 739 898
250 SR 320 554 784 954
250 DR 355 616 872 -
300 SR 335 582 825 1002
300 DR 390 676 955 1165
350 SR 350 607 860 1044
350 DR 425 733 1037 1261
400 SR 365 607 860 1044
400 DR 450 784 1112 1350
450 SR 375 650 920 1119
450 DR 480 833 1180 1434
500 SR 385 668 947 1151
500 DR 505 880 1245 1513
550 SR 395 686 972 1180
550 DR 535 923 1307 1589
600 SR 405 703 994 1208
600 DR 560 966 1367 1661
650 SR 415 718 1016 1235
650 DR 580 1006 1425 1731
700 SR 425 733 1036 1260
700 DR 605 1045 1479 1798

Options

HCP’s perimeter casing can be modified to suit your requirements, which can include split mullions for partition points. Acoustic baffles can be integrated within out units to counter the transfer of noise between rooms.

Cabling is often integrated within our units and you can choose between a high or low-level cable duct; Separate and multi-cable ducts are also available.
